How many listeners can I expect to hear my ad?
In general, Earmark podcasts tend to have higher listener completion rates than other podcasts due to the CPE educational component, but there is still some drop off when it comes to listening to the entire episode. The following can be used to calculate your expected number of listeners The Accounting Podcast 80% of listeners will hear the A-Slot 65% of listeners will hear the B-Slot 55% of listeners will hear the C-Slot 50% of listeners will hear the D-Slot 35% of listeners will hear the Cl

How many clicks to my website can I expect?
Podcast advertising in general does not drive a lot of direct clicks. Due to the nature of podcast listening, many times folks are listening when driving, exercising, doing laundry or house hold chores making clicking links in show notes difficult.
